I don't know if she ever used the term, but Dorothy Taubman was one of the great teachers of "flow" in music.
She took a stand against musical training for technical endurance and discovered the physical principles that allow the fingers, wrists, arms, and entire body to work in harmony.
If you ever experience an injury playing any music instrument, her insights could make the difference between sustaining injury and opening up to euphoria.
Dorothy Taubman (August 16, 1917 – April 3, 2013)
